Chris Brown (running back)
Christopher Rejean Brown (born April 17, 1981) is an American former professional football player who was a running back in the National Football League (NFL). He played college football for the Colorado Buffales, earning first-team All-American honors in 2002. He was selected by the Tennessee Titans in the third round of the 2003 NFL draft.
